Rare heat
A red kite passed between the sun and I momentarily delighting with its shadow, a shrill cry launched at an empty sky, happy Hot creosote of neighbours fences smelt of care and the eighties while my own untreated panels bleached By the stream, illegal fishermen dawdled while the world chose not to care and for now this snow globe held unshook
